Best SBA 7(a) lenders for art dealers

NAICS 453920 — Art Dealers.
66 7(a) loans approved in this industry between FY2020 and 2025-12-31, totaling $21.2M.

Methodology

Computed from the SBA 7(a) FOIA dataset (as of 2025-12-31), filtered to NAICS code 453920. Charge-off rates are calculated on the FY2020–FY2023 cohort only.
